In the current economic climate, Australian governments will benefit from superior choice experiments which will lead to improved prediction of the potential public benefit of proposed policy changes. The choice experiments developed here will have a substantial effect on the development of strategies for the promotion and maintenance of a strong health care system as well as being relevant to the maintenance of a sustainable environment, both designated National Research Priority areas. The outcomes of the research will significantly improve ....An intelligent maintenance decision system for the water utility industry. The reliability and maintenance of pump stations is of paramount importance to the water utility industries. In Australia, the maintenance of assets for the water and wastewater industry amounts to $927m per annum. This research will develop an intelligent maintenance decision support system to reduce maintenance costs in pumping stations with increased reliability. The outcomes of the research will significantly improve the reliability and supply security of water systems to Queensland's rural and regional communities and industries. It will also advance the body of knowledge of the field of integrated asset management and enhance Australia's international standing in this field.Read moreRead less

This probabilistic approach to the discove ....Unsupervised learning of finite mixture models in data mining applications. The extraction of useful information from massively large databases is known as data mining. Its broad but vague goal is to find "interesting structure" in the data, which typically leads to breaking the data into clusters. To this end, we consider the fast, efficient, and automatic learning of finite mixture models in hugh data sets without any prior knowledge of the structure. This probabilistic approach to the discovery and validation of group structure in data mining applications will considerably enhance knowledge management and decision support in science, industry, and government.

These techniques will allow a researcher to use information obtained from a set o ....Nonlinear Econometric Modelling: A Complex Systems Perspective. It is becoming increasingly accepted that economic systems are both complex and adaptive. However, this introduces a range of problems in constructing, estimating and testing economic models using time series data. In this project, this problem will be addressed through the formulation and implementation of a new methodology and associated techniques. These techniques will allow a researcher to use information obtained from a set of nonlinearity tests to determine which type of nonlinear model provides the best representation of a data generating mechanism. Selected high frequency financial and macroeconomic data (for the US and Australia) will be used in the study. This research is intended to change the direction and emphasis of econometric modelling and promises to have a fundamental impact on forecasting and policy evaluation methods.

This project aims to integrate statistical methodologies in neural networks to provide a unified approach to improve its ....On-line and Incremental EM-based Neural Networks: Application to Hospital Utlilization and Gene Expression Data. Artificial neural networks have been widely applied as universal classifiers in many fields, such as biomedicine. However, misunderstanding of fundamental statistical principles, which can cause misleading findings, has been frequently observed in the literature. This project aims to integrate statistical methodologies in neural networks to provide a unified approach to improve its applicability and efficiency in implementation. The system developed from this proposed cross-disciplinary research will be applied to hospital utilization data (hospital morbidity database, Western Australia) and gene expression data (DNA microarrays databases, Harvard University). This collaborative research will advance the international standard of Australian research communities.
